Kundra c a Bharat Heavy Electricals Limited, Hyderabad, India b Instrument Research & Development Establishment, Dehradun, India c Department of Mechanical Engineering, IIT Delhi, Delhi, India Accepted 25 May 2004 Available online 2 October 2004 Abstract The aim of the present work is to develop updated FE models ofa drilling machine using analytical and experimental results. These updated FE models have been used to predict thee? ect of structural dynamic modifications on vibration characteristics of the drilling machine. Two studies have been carried out on the machine. In the first study, modal tests have been carried out ona drilling machine using instrumented impact hammer. Modal identification has been done using global method of modal identification. For ana-lytical FE modeling of the machine, puter program has been developed. The results obtained using FEM, have been correlated with the experimental ones using mode parison and MAC values. Analytical FE model has been updated, with the help ofa program, which has been developed using direct methods of model updating.
